Selecting a Breathable Cap Men Can Wear Daily

Comfort isn't just about how the hat fits around your temples; it’s also about how it manages temperature. A breathable cap men can wear daily must be able to handle changing environments. Moving from a cold air-conditioned office to a warm afternoon sun requires a fabric that can adapt and breathe.

  • Linen-cotton blends offer the best of both worlds.

  • Eyelets or mesh panels can provide extra ventilation.

  • Unstructured crowns allow for more airflow.

  • Lightweight materials prevent "hat hair" caused by excessive sweat.

How to Style Your Cap

The versatility of this headwear is unmatched. It can be dressed up with a waistcoat for a vintage-inspired look or dressed down with a denim jacket for a rugged, modern vibe. The key is to match the fabric of the cap to the season and the formality of your clothing.

  1. Choose tweed or wool for autumn and winter.

  2. Opt for light cotton for spring outings.

  3. Select pale colors like beige or light grey for summer.

  4. Keep the pattern simple if your outfit is busy.
